Nonprofit wins Housing for Everyone grant

A Woonsocket nonprofit was a winner of this year’s Housing for Everyone grant competition put on by the TD Charitable Foundation.
The foundation, a charitable arm of TD Bank, earlier this month announced winners of $2.5 million in grants, which included the Woonsocket Neighborhood Development Corp., of Woonsocket. The grants aim to bolster affordable housing efforts in states from Maine to Florida, according to a Dec. 3 press release.
“Each year it is our pleasure to support housing agencies that are making a difference in the community,” said Beth Warn, president of the charity, in a statement. “Affordable housing affects thousands and we are proud to partner with agencies to address this critical need.”
Organizations participating in the grant competition had to be nonprofits that “develop or maintain affordable housing, or provide housing-related programs and services to very low-, low- and moderate-income individuals and families,” according to the release.
Woonsocket Neighborhood Development Corp. is the only winner from Rhode Island, according to the release, but other nonprofits were located in Connecticut, Florida, Maine,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, New Jersey,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, Vermont and Washington, D.C.
